Drugged driver crashes into U.S. Embassy

JAKARTA (JP): A green Honda Accord sedan crashed into the front gates of the American Embassy on Jl. Medan Merdeka in Central Jakarta at about 3 a.m. on Sunday, an officer said.

According to First Sergeant Sinaga of the Central Jakarta Police intelligence unit, the driver, identified only as Habib, was believed to have been under the influence of amphetamines when the accident took place.

"When he was brought to the Central Jakarta Police station, he was very paranoid. A police doctor tested him and found out that he was high on amphetamines," Sinaga told The Jakarta Post.

Sinaga added that the gates were badly damaged, but the driver was not hurt.

"The driver is originally from Bandung, West Java. He has been transferred to the Kramat Jati Police hospital for further drug tests.

"Members of his family said that he had just got out from a drug rehabilitation center," the officer explained. (ylt)
